What to Expect During the Workshop

Once you arrive, you’ll be greeted by the friendly staff of Emotuft Tufting Studio, known for guiding over 3,000 tufting enthusiasts annually. You’ll start with a brief introduction to tufting, a textile technique that involves using a tufting gun to create textured, plush surfaces.

The main activity involves learning how to operate a tufting gun, which may sound intimidating but is surprisingly straightforward with proper guidance. The studio provides all necessary tools and materials, so you don’t need any prior experience. You’ll have the opportunity to create various items—rugs, tote bags, mirrors, or cushions—customized to your style or preferences.

The Creative Process

Participants typically spend about 90 minutes in the workshop, during which you’ll:

  • Choose your design or pattern (some studios offer templates, but creativity is encouraged)
  • Practice using the tufting gun, with one-on-one guidance from instructors
  • Watch your design come to life as you tuft away, resulting in a handmade, textured product

Many reviews point out that the studio’s supportive atmosphere makes it easy for beginners to pick up the technique quickly. One reviewer mentioned that the instructor was especially patient, walking through each step carefully, which is crucial for a craft that requires some finesse.
